## Feathercast Validator Environments

Quick tour for the security review: the feed validator runs in three environments, but only prod accepts feeds from the open internet. Dev and staging pull from a fixture bucket, so don't panic about the relaxed TLS settings there. Prod enforces strict fetch timeouts, a URL allowlist for redirects, and size caps on enclosure metadata. Parsing happens in an isolated worker with no outbound network beyond the fetch proxy. The prod instance boots with the configuration shown below.

config for kafof-bawef:
holath:
  log_level: debug
  metrics_host: metrics.holath.qorvelsys.internal
  pin: 2191
  pool_size: 32

MEMO — Vexley Instruments
To: Incoming Director

Welcome aboard! Quick primer on next year's headcount plan: we're budgeting for eight new roles, mostly engineering in the Darrowfield office, plus one ops lead. Attrition assumptions are conservative at 5%. Greta left detailed notes in the planning folder — worth a skim before your first leadership sync. The confidential context behind these numbers follows.

internal memo for fajog-yagaf: Gross margin on Ulaael came in at 20 percent against a plan of 10 percent. Only 9 of the 80 pilot accounts renewed Ulaael, so a churn review is set for July 1.

Step 4: Snapshot verification. Run the Glintworks snapshot suite against the Pinebranch UI components before tagging. All diffs must be approved or reverted — no pending snapshots at deploy time. Regenerate baselines only on the release branch, never main. If the Cardamine button set drifts, flag it to the design lead and abort. Once the suite is green, archive the snapshot report to the release folder and sign the artifact bundle. Use the deploy key below.

rollout seal: bky4_x7Gc